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Debt recovery matters may require court involvement, particularly if the debtor disputes the claim or refuses to pay despite your efforts to resolve it outside the legal system. Whether court action becomes necessary depends on several factors, including the debt amount, the debtor's response to your initial claims, and the complexity of the dispute. Some cases can be resolved through negotiation or alternative dispute resolution, whilst others may progress to formal court proceedings. Based on your location in St Leonards, NSW, one nearby court location is: Supreme Court of New South Wales 184 Phillip Street, Sydney This location is provided for general context only. Debt recovery matters are typically handled in the Local Court for smaller claims or the District Court for larger amounts, though the Supreme Court may be involved in complex disputes.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Debt Recovery lawyers cost in St Leonards, NSW?
Debt recovery lawyers in St Leonards, NSW generally charge between $250 and $500 per hour, with rates varying based on the lawyer's experience, location and firm size. Total costs depend significantly on the time required to resolve your matter. Straightforward debt collection letters or payment demand notices typically require fewer hours and fall at the lower end of the cost spectrum. Medium complexity matters involving negotiation with debtors or reviewing security documents sit in the mid-range, while complex disputes requiring court appearances, formal proceedings or enforcement actions demand extensive preparation and result in higher total costs.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Debt Recovery lawyer in St Leonards, NSW?
Gathering your paperwork beforehand can streamline your initial consultation with a debt recovery lawyer in St Leonards, NSW. It can help to have photo identification, any invoices or contracts related to the outstanding debt, and records of communication with the debtor (emails, letters, or payment demands you've sent). If available, bank statements showing missed payments, proof of goods delivered or services provided, and any existing payment agreements can be useful. You may also be asked to provide company registration details if the debt involves a business entity.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
